Description of our neighbourhood and surrounding area
Willunga is a very attractive small market town about 45 minutes drive south of Adelaide. It’s famous for its weekly Farmers’ Market, where you can buy a wide range of locally-grown produce but there is also a range of local shops, including a
bakery, butcher, chemist, hairdresser, some well-regarded restaurants, and three pubs, all serving meals. It is situated in the
southern Vale’s wine area and the surrounding country side has numerous vineyards and cellar doors where you can sample the
vintage wine and where there are excellent restaurants for lunch or dinner.
It is ideally situated for exploring the Adelaide Hills, the Fleurieu Peninsula, the Southern Vales Wine region and is within easy reach of the Kangaroo Island ferry. The centre of Adelaide, with all its shops, is easily accessible and also the beautiful Fleurieu peninsular, Victor Harbor, and little coastal settlements such as Port Noarlunga.
It’s only a 40 minute drive to the German settlement of Hahndorf and other tourist spots such as Mount Lofty, and the Barossa Valley and Clare Valley are easily accessible day trips.
Adelaide's climate is Mediterranean and although hot (35c-45c) in summer (Dec-March) it is usually mild and warm in autumn and spring which are the best times to visit. Winter daytime temperature is around 15c but can range from 10c-20c. and winter here is very much like an English spring. South Australia gets as much sunshine and less rain than Queensland in summer.
Adelaide is considered to be the gateway to the Outback, and tours are available from Adelaide to the Flinders Ranges, Uluru (Ayers Rock), Alice Springs and the opal mining town of Coober Pedy. It is also well-situated for visiting other states by car or planes or, if you enjoy train travel, the Indian Pacific leaves Adelaide for Perth or Sydney and the Ghan to Alice Springs and Darwin.
